Araku Valley Andhra Pradesh – Top Attractions, Best Time & Travel Guide

Araku Valley, nestled in the Eastern Ghats of Andhra Pradesh, is a serene hill station known for its lush coffee plantations, rolling hills, and cool climate. Often called the “Ooty of Andhra Pradesh,” this valley is a perfect escape for nature lovers, adventure seekers, and those looking to unwind amidst breathtaking landscapes.

Top Attractions in Araku Valley

  • Borra Caves – Stunning limestone caves with stalactite and stalagmite formations.

  • Coffee Plantations – Explore the aromatic coffee estates and visit the Coffee Museum.

  • Katiki Waterfalls – A refreshing natural spot ideal for trekking and relaxation.

  • Tribal Museum – Learn about the local tribal culture, history, and art.

  • Galikonda Viewpoint – Offers panoramic views of the valley and surrounding mountains.

Best Time to Visit

The ideal time to visit Araku Valley is October to March, when the weather is cool and pleasant, making it perfect for sightseeing and outdoor activities.

How to Reach

  • By Air – The nearest airport is Visakhapatnam (112 km away).

  • By Train – Araku Railway Station is connected via a scenic train route from Visakhapatnam.

  • By Road – Well-connected by buses and taxis from nearby cities.
